35 days into flower and the tent is dense! Maybe 5 weeks or over to go.

I've got quite abit of growth under the canopy receiving no light. Iknow its to late to cut off budsites as I don't want to stress them too much. I'm thinking of just the leafs. There starting to become abit unhappy and droopy. Slightly discolouring. Humidity abit high so I thought maybe cutting away abit will help air movement.

What's your thought? Leave them be? Cut a few at a time?

Cutting them out will clear room for air movement. Looking at your grow style it's similar to me, scrog but let them go for the stars ๐Ÿ˜‚. I find a noticeable difference in humidity drop after a heavy defol in flower.

As for the bud sites.... Take em off a Coul ple a day if you are sure they are not gojng to do anything lower down. Tbh I heavy defol around this exact time in flower and have never had a hermy due to it. If worried take a few leaves and bits off each feed. It will help your humidity.
